内容简介


Offering some of the most advanced thinking and practice in the arena of social work with groups, "From Prevention to Wellness Through Group Work" synthesizes the discussions and findings from the Annual Symposium of the Association for the Advancement of Social Work with Groups (AASWG). Gathered here are different ideas, techniques, and research (with a focus on prevention) for group work with seniors, adults, teens, and children. With a mix of authors from social work academia and practice, this book gives you groundbreaking theoretical pieces as well as emerging skills and techniques in group work. The two primary chapters in "From Prevention to Wellness Through Group Work" provide a look into constructivism and the power model and the empowerment approach as a paradigm for international social work practice. Other pertinent topics you learn about include: conflict management in group treatment a social skills program for emotionally disturbed children bullying and scapegoating in groups for persons who have experienced transplants groups for persons with AIDS the intersection of different realities in the group setting using poetry to revive traditional practice methods, theories, and values mutual aid, democratic participation, power sharing, and consciousness raising. "From Prevention to Wellness Through Group Work" also shows you how group experiences prevent breakdown and encourage wellness for older adults in senior centers and retirement communities; the definition, scope, and usefulness of psychoeducational groups; how group-based methods can enrich research; and, how monitoring group practice can strengthen your effectiveness and credibility.
